NTC orders deactivation of validates clickable person-to-person URL in malicious text messages

IN a step to further curb the proliferation of SMS text scams and illicit spam messages, National Telecommunications Commission (NTC) ordered the deactivation of domains and Uniform Resource Locators (URLs) that have been identified and validated to be linked to malicious text messages being sent to the public by fraudsters.

In a Memorandum dated 12 September 2022, the NTC directed telcos Dito Telecommunity Corporation, Globe Telecom, Inc. and Smart Communications, Inc. “to block or deactivate domains or Uniform Resource Locators (URLs), TinyURLs, Smart Links and/or QR Codes emanating from malicious sites based on existing database culled from government agencies such as the National Telecommunications Commission, National Privacy Commission, Department of Trade and Industry, law enforcement agencies, subscriber reports and those generated from machine learning or artificial intelligence.”

URLs are the links included in text scams and illicit spam messages where recipients are baited by scammers to click which then directs the victim to a fake website or initiates the fraud process by some malicious scheme or another.

Once deactivated or blocked, recipients who click on these fraudulent links will no longer be able to access the site online.
